Transaction 528166671741892a2ce7ceeec5cf6bd43dac5b9c261deee46fd5cb25073a8320

2 Input
2 Outputs
  • 528166671741892a2ce7ceeec5cf6bd43dac5b9c261deee46fd5cb25073a8320:0
  • value  2446000
    address  16L1VjjvMYLdGWk65LpLXwC6v5AAtKdjYh
  • 528166671741892a2ce7ceeec5cf6bd43dac5b9c261deee46fd5cb25073a8320:1
  • value  1073810
    address  35Ks77cG8LZgTSPNSWdpTrHbHazEg9NyGL